Randomness is a fundamental concept in online casino games, as it ensures that the outcome of each game is unpredictable and fair. This is achieved through the use of random number generators (RNGs), which are algorithms that generate random sequences of numbers. These RNGs are constantly running in the background of online casino games, ensuring that the outcome of each spin of the slot machine or hand of cards is completely random.
Probability, on the other hand, is the likelihood of a particular outcome occurring in a game of chance. In online casino games, probability plays a crucial role in determining the odds of winning or losing. For example, in a game of roulette, the probability of the ball landing on a particular number or color is determined by the layout of the wheel and the rules of the game.
To help players understand the role of randomness and probability in online casino games, let's take a closer look at some of the most popular games and how these concepts apply to them:
1. Slot Machines: Slot machines are perhaps the most popular online casino game, and they rely heavily on randomness to determine the outcome of each spin. The symbols on the reels are randomized by the RNG, ensuring that each spin is independent of the previous one. The probability of winning a jackpot on a slot machine is determined by the placement of the symbols on the reels and the number of paylines.
2. Blackjack: In blackjack, the outcome of each hand is influenced by both randomness and probability. The cards are shuffled before each hand, ensuring that the order of the cards is random. The probability of being dealt a particular hand, such as a blackjack or a bust, is determined by the number of decks in play and the rules of the game.
3. Roulette: In roulette, the outcome of each spin of the wheel is purely random, with each number on the wheel having an equal probability of landing. The probability of the ball landing on a particular number or color is determined by the layout of the wheel and the rules of the game.
4. Poker: Poker is a game of skill as well as luck, with the outcome of each hand influenced by both randomness and probability. The cards are shuffled before each hand, ensuring that the order of the cards is random. The probability of being dealt a particular hand, such as a straight or a flush, is determined by the number of cards in the deck and the rules of the game.
